anyhow...here's my first foray into the realm of raw/selvage denim. i've been wearing sfam jeans and whatnot for a while not, and was intrigued by this new raw/selvage denim i keep seeing around. did some searching around here and stumbled on a list of affordable raws so i jumped on it! (no i don't work for onvis, or anyway affiliated with them). not really a fan of super skinny jeans, and the pictures on onvis' website looked good, but no one has really said anything about onvis here, so i took the plunge and ordered a pair. they came DHL yesterday and i wore them out to the bar last night and to run some errands today. figured id show you guys some pics.
first of all...after wearing "premium denim" such as sfam i was mighty impressed by the workmanship of these when i opened up the torn package i received from DHL. stitching and detailing seems top notch to me! i normally wear a size 30-31 depending on stretch of said denim, but after measuring out some of my worn in denim decided to order a size 29. they're a bit snug when i first put them on, but after a few hours of moving around they've gotten a little less snug and are starting to feel great.

anyway, for 75bucks i'm happy with my purchase. one thing that does bug me is the button fly, not that big a deal, just takes an extra minute to button the jeans after visiting the bathroom. although im wondering if i should have them hemmed as i normally am between a 29/30 on the inseem, and these come in 34. however i keep reading some people suggest letting them wear to get nice fades before hemming too much. what is your opinion sf? should i cuff them for now? or just wear them normally?
